Famous Michelangelo Quotes



A beautiful thing never gives so much pain as does failing to hear and see it.

Michelangelo

I am a poor man and of little worth, who is laboring in that art that God has given me in order to extend my life as long as possible.

Michelangelo

The best of artists has no conception that the marble alone does not contain within itself.

Michelangelo

It is necessary to keep one’s compass in one’s eyes and not in the hand, for the hands execute, but the eye judges.

Michelangelo

If in my youth I had realized that the sustaining splendour of beauty of with which I was in love would one day flood back into my heart, there to ignite a flame that would torture me without end, how gladly would I have put out the light in my eyes.

Michelangelo

There is no greater harm than that of time wasted.

Michelangelo

Good painting is the kind that looks like sculpture.

Michelangelo

Every beauty which is seen here by persons of perception resembles more than anything else that celestial source from which we all are come.

Michelangelo

It is well with me only when I have a chisel in my hand.

Michelangelo

The promises of this world are, for the most part, vain phantoms; and to confide in one's self, and become something of worth and value is the best and safest course.

Michelangelo

In every block of marble I see a statue as plain as though it stood before me, shaped and perfect in attitude and action. I have only to hew away the rough walls that imprison the lovely apparition to reveal it to the other eyes as mine see it.

Michelangelo

Let whoever may have attained to so much as to have the power of drawing know that he holds a great treasure.

Michelangelo
